ChatGPT

  1. lucifugal

    Lucifugal refers to something or someone that shuns or avoids light, particularly sunlight. It is often used in reference to creatures that are active during the night and hide from light during the day. It originates from the Latin words 'lucifer' meaning light-bringing and 'fugere' meaning to flee. Therefore, it literally translates to 'fleeing from light'.
